Unauthenticated memory corruption via oversized funcpara1
Published Mar 12, 2026 · Updated Mar 12, 2026
Stack-based buffer overflow in the HTTP handler of Tenda W3 1.0.0.3(2204) allows remote attackers to corrupt process memory. The formSetCfm function handling POST requests to /goform/setcfm accepts an oversized funcpara1 value and writes it past a stack buffer. The endpoint is reachable without authentication only from an adjacent local network; the public proof of concept demonstrates the trigger, but published sources establish neither code execution nor a specific crash outcome.
